Ukrainian refugees move onto Edinburgh cruise ship

The MS Victoria has 739 rooms and will initially house between 1,600 and 1,700 people. About 9,000 refugees have made their way to Scotland since war broke out in Ukraine. But earlier this month the Scottish government had to suspend its super-sponsor scheme due to a shortage of suitable housing. Shona Robison, cabinet secretary for social justice, housing and local government, said the "safety and welfare of displaced people from Ukraine, who are primarily women and children who may have experienced much stress and trauma, is of paramount importance". Hungary PM Viktor Orban adviser Hegedus resigns over ‘pure Nazi’ speech

A member of Viktor Orban's inner circle has resigned after the Hungarian prime minister spoke out against becoming a "mixed race". Zsuzsa Hegedus, who has known the nationalist Mr Orban for 20 years, described the speech as a "pure Nazi text", according to Hungarian media. The International Auschwitz Committee of Holocaust survivors called the speech "stupid and dangerous". Mr Orban's spokesman said the media had misrepresented the comments. The speech took place on Saturday in a region of Romania which has a large Hungarian community. Portugal stag holiday stabbing victim in induced coma

Father of four Joel Collins, 35, from Ebbw Vale, Blaenau Gwent, was on holiday in Albufeira with friends when he was stabbed four times on 4 July as he walked back to his hotel. He remains in an induced coma in intensive care. Mr Collins's mum Sue Bridges said: "My boy is my world and I have been by his side every day for three weeks." She added: "I am not going anywhere until he comes home with me." His mum told BBC Wales she hopes to be by her son's bedside after his surgery."It is the most horrendous experience of my life but what his sister, his partner and I are going through is nothing compared to what Joel is so that makes me stronger."
